Clara Mattei, economist and author of The Capital Order, argues that austerity is not a neutral economic policy but a tool historically used to suppress working-class power and preserve capitalist order—even under fascism.Guest Bio: Clara E. Mattei is an Assistant Professor of Economics at The New School for Social Research in New York City. Economist Clara Mattei explains how austerity policies—like budget cuts and wage suppression—were historically used to keep working people in line and protect the wealthy. She compares modern democracies to early fascist regimes, arguing both use similar tactics to maintain capitalist control. Mattei also explores alternatives to our current system, including democratic ways to organize work and production.
